当前位置:首页 > 综合资讯 > 正文
黑狐家游戏

阿里云对象存储和文件存储的区别,深入剖析阿里云对象存储与文件存储的区别与应用场景

阿里云对象存储和文件存储的区别,深入剖析阿里云对象存储与文件存储的区别与应用场景

阿里云对象存储与文件存储区别显著。对象存储以对象为单位,适合大规模非结构化数据存储;文件存储以文件系统为基础,适合结构化数据存储。应用场景上,对象存储适用于图片、视频等...

阿里云对象存储与文件存储区别显著。对象存储以对象为单位,适合大规模非结构化数据存储;文件存储以文件系统为基础,适合结构化数据存储。应用场景上,对象存储适用于图片、视频等大数据存储,而文件存储适用于文档、系统文件等。两者在性能、安全性、扩展性等方面各有优劣,需根据实际需求选择。

随着互联网的快速发展,数据量呈爆炸式增长,如何高效、安全地存储和管理海量数据成为各大企业关注的焦点,阿里云作为国内领先的云计算服务商,提供了丰富的存储服务,其中包括对象存储和文件存储,本文将深入剖析阿里云对象存储与文件存储的区别,以及它们各自的应用场景。

阿里云对象存储与文件存储的区别

1、存储方式

对象存储:以对象为单位存储数据,每个对象由唯一标识符(Object Name)、元数据(Meta Data)和内容(Content)组成,对象存储适合存储非结构化数据,如图片、视频、音频等。

文件存储:以文件为单位存储数据,文件系统提供文件路径、文件名、文件大小等元数据,文件存储适合存储结构化数据,如文档、表格等。

2、存储结构

阿里云对象存储和文件存储的区别,深入剖析阿里云对象存储与文件存储的区别与应用场景

对象存储:采用分布式存储架构,具有高可用性、高性能和可扩展性,对象存储通常采用多级索引,方便快速检索。

文件存储:采用传统的文件系统存储结构,如EXT4、XFS等,文件存储的扩展性相对较差,且在并发访问时性能可能受到影响。

3、访问方式

对象存储:通过HTTP/HTTPS协议进行访问,支持RESTful API,对象存储支持跨地域访问,适用于全球用户。

文件存储:通过NFS、SMB等协议进行访问,支持跨平台访问,文件存储适用于局域网内部用户访问。

4、安全性

对象存储:提供数据加密、访问控制、安全审计等功能,确保数据安全。

文件存储:提供文件级别的访问控制,但安全性相对较低。

5、应用场景

阿里云对象存储和文件存储的区别,深入剖析阿里云对象存储与文件存储的区别与应用场景

对象存储:适用于大规模非结构化数据存储,如图片、视频、音频等,在云上应用、大数据、人工智能等领域具有广泛应用。

文件存储:适用于结构化数据存储,如文档、表格等,在办公自动化、企业内部系统等领域具有广泛应用。

应用场景对比

1、大规模非结构化数据存储

对象存储:适用于大规模非结构化数据存储,如云盘、云盘备份、CDN加速等。

文件存储:不适用于大规模非结构化数据存储,可能因性能瓶颈导致应用受限。

2、结构化数据存储

对象存储:不适用于结构化数据存储,可能因数据格式不兼容导致应用受限。

文件存储:适用于结构化数据存储,如企业内部文档、表格等。

3、跨地域访问

阿里云对象存储和文件存储的区别,深入剖析阿里云对象存储与文件存储的区别与应用场景

对象存储:支持跨地域访问,适用于全球用户。

文件存储:仅支持局域网内部用户访问。

4、并发访问

对象存储:具有高可用性、高性能,适用于高并发场景。

文件存储:在并发访问时性能可能受到影响,适用于低并发场景。

阿里云对象存储与文件存储在存储方式、存储结构、访问方式、安全性和应用场景等方面存在明显区别,企业应根据自身业务需求选择合适的存储服务,对于大规模非结构化数据存储、跨地域访问和高并发场景,对象存储更具优势;而对于结构化数据存储和局域网内部访问,文件存储更合适。

黑狐家游戏

发表评论

最新文章